How CryptoNote Technology Works: The Privacy Engine

CryptoNote’s architecture employs three revolutionary mechanisms to ensure anonymity:

  • Ring Signatures: Mixes your transaction with others’ to obscure the sender
  • Stealth Addresses: Generates unique one-time addresses for each transaction
  • Ring Confidential Transactions (RingCT): Hides transaction amounts

This triple-layer approach creates an opaque veil around all transaction details, making CryptoNote coins virtually untraceable compared to pseudonymous alternatives.

Top CryptoNote-Based Cryptocurrencies

  • Monero (XMR): The flagship implementation with mandatory privacy
  • Bytecoin (BCN): The original CryptoNote cryptocurrency
  • Haven Protocol (XHV): Privacy-focused stablecoin ecosystem
  • Masari (MSR): Lightweight alternative with faster transactions

Why CryptoNote Matters: 5 Key Advantages

  1. True Financial Privacy: Breaks the traceability chain completely
  2. Fungibility Guarantee: Coins can’t be blacklisted due to transaction history
  3. ASIC Resistance: Memory-intensive mining promotes decentralization
  4. Adaptive Parameters: Dynamic block sizes prevent congestion
  5. Open-Source Development: Continuously upgraded by global contributors

Q: Is CryptoNote the same as cryptocurrency?
A: No – CryptoNote is the underlying technology, while cryptocurrencies like Monero are implementations of it.

Q: Why choose CryptoNote over VPN or Tor?
A: VPNs/Tor hide your IP but not transaction details. CryptoNote protects both identity AND financial data on-chain.
